There is one group that has been front and center through it all. In fact they have always been the first ones you see when you enter many health facilities, nurses. This week is Nurses Week and this year the theme is “We Answer the Call”.

Canadian Nurses Association declares May 9-15 National Nurses Week

 

Now today also happens to be a special day in the history of this profession. May 12th was the birthday of the “founder of modern nursing” Florence Nightingale.
